Which Bible
I am a new Christian and am pondering over which Bible I should buy.
I have decided on the NIV version, mainly because this is the version that my church use and because it seems to be easier to understand.
I have been looking on the internet and found a Life Application Bible which gives historical context to each of the Books in the Bible, and gives a narrative to explain each passage in the bible. I know that there are other similar Bibles and some that are set out in Chronlogical Order.
Would I be better off with one of these Bible or just buy an "ordinary" Bible and buy Bible Study Notes to accompany it??
